1A, Muckross Crescent, Perrystown, Dublin 12
RefusedPlanning application SD21B/0362
Dublin - South Dublin County Council
Proposed Development
Single storey garden structure of 18.4sq.m to the south east of site to accommodate plant room and storage/recreation space; mature screen planting to front, side and rear and all associated site development works.
